Price Not Guilty
(N.Z.P.A.-Reuter—Copyright) LEICESTER. The disciplinary committee of the Leicestershire Rugby Union decided on Monday that the Welsh international and British Lion, T. G. Price, was not guilty of foul play when he was sent off during a match earlier this month. Price was sent off the field by thfe referee, Mr R. Kemp, when captaining Leicester University against Nottingham University on November 9. He was placed under suspension by the Welsh Rugby Union on the day after he had been sent off and missed the first Welsh trial. Now Price will be available
for Wales’ opening international game of the season, against Australia on December 3.
